A DISGRACEFUL AFFAIR.

Two Men Get Into a Bad Fight at a School Entertainment. Last Saturday night, at. Fair Oaks, one of the most disgraceful affairs that lias happened in Jasper county for some time took plaoe. The Fair Oaks schools were giving a public entertainment for the benefit of the library. The entertainment was largely attended, the house being crowded. In the audience was Riohard Meyerp, a young man badly undfer the influence of liquor, who, with loud talk and vulgar language, greatly distnrbed tlie exercises. Towards the close of the entertainment his conduct became especially offensive, and Ed. Griggs started to eject him from the building. Meyers struck Griggs, and the latter then lost his temper, and gave Meyers a beating that he will not soon forget It is said that Meyers was rendered unconscious by the blows received. The fight almost caused a panic in the building, and one lady fainted. The curses of the fighters and the screams of the women anJ children added to the confusion. The fight put a stop to the entertainment, which would otherwise have been the most successful one ever held in Fair Oaks. Griggs has been arrested for assault and battery, and Meyers for provoke and for disturbing a public meeting. They will have their hearing in the circuit court. ■
